- Compliance Requirements for Washington Registered Agents
- In Washington, registered agents play a crucial role in ensuring that businesses comply with state regulations. A registered agent must have a tangible address in Washington, which serves as the official contact point for receiving legal documents, such as lawsuits or legal notices. This address cannot be a P.O. Box; it must be a physical location where the registered agent can be reliably reached during normal business hours.
- Moreover, the registered agent must be accessible during standard business hours to receive and forward important documents to the business owner. This requirement makes certain that businesses are quickly notified of any legal proceedings or compliance documents that require timely action. Failing to maintain an operational registered agent can lead to significant legal consequences, including the potential for automated rulings against the business.
